Justin Tridot quits his party

Ready to resign from the leadership of the ruling Liberal Party appears its prime minister . As broadcast by Reuters, a source that spoke in the newspapers “Globe” and “Mail” Justin Tridot is expected to announce within the day Monday (7,1.25) his resignation from the Liberal Party leadership in Canada after nine years. CORVERSE If Trido does resign, the Canadian Liberals will remain “headed” and while polls show that they are far short of the main opposition Conservatives ahead of the elections expected to take place in late October. It is noted that more and more Liberal MPs over the last few years have invited Tridot to leave the party. However, it is not yet clear whether Tridot leaves immediately or if he remains prime minister until a new leader of the Liberals is chosen. Trido took over president of the Liberals in 2013 at a difficult time for the party as he was a third parliamentary force in the Canadian House of Commons. Should Trido leave the Prime Minister, too, it is certain that pressure will be intensified to hold early elections so that there will soon be a new stable government.
